    It's an open space for buses. Most cars park there during the week, there are no shops but there is a toilet. I don't know how clean it is, I've never used it. Taxi's to Cape Town park there as well. It is really quiet on weekends. There's a lot of movement during the week. St Mark's Square is between two primary schools,a business centre. And students from Nelson Mandela University, George Campus get their shuttle here.
